  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/LIME/CORE640 - Error during update of cancelation ?

    The SAP error message /LIME/CORE640 Error during update of cancellation typically occurs in the context of the Logistics Information Management (LIM) module, particularly when dealing with cancellation processes in SAP. This error can arise due to various reasons, and understanding the cause is essential for finding an appropriate solution.

    Causes:

    1. Data Inconsistencies: There may be inconsistencies in the data being processed, such as missing or incorrect entries in the database.
    2.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to perform the cancellation operation.
    3. System Configuration: Incorrect configuration settings in the system can lead to errors during the update process.
    4. Lock Entries: If another process is currently accessing the same data, it may lead to a lock situation, preventing the cancellation from being processed.
    5. Custom Code Issues: If there are custom enhancements or modifications in the system, they may interfere with the standard cancellation process.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Data Consistency: Verify the data related to the cancellation. Ensure that all necessary entries exist and are correct.
    2. Review Authorizations: Check the user’s authorization profile to ensure they have the necessary permissions to perform the cancellation.
    3. System Configuration Review: Review the configuration settings related to the cancellation process in the LIM module. Ensure that they are set up correctly.
    4. Check for Locks: Use transaction codes like SM12 to check for any lock entries that might be preventing the update. If locks are found, you may need to wait for them to be released or contact the user holding the lock.
    5. Debugging: If the issue persists, consider debugging the process to identify where the error occurs. This may require the assistance of a developer or SAP Basis team.
    6. Review Custom Code: If there are custom enhancements, review the code to ensure it is not causing the issue. You may need to consult with the development team for this.
    7. SAP Notes: Check the SAP Support Portal for any relevant SAP Notes that may address this specific error. There may be patches or updates available that resolve the issue.
